This is the moment thousands of caterpillars cling to the trunk of a tree from the base to the top in Quang Ninh, Vietnam.

The man who filmed this video was walking in the forest near his house when he suddenly saw this.

The animals swarm from the base of the tree to the top and surround their yellow nests in the middle of the trunk.

This was the first time the man had witnessed such a scene. He said the fur of this worm is venomous, and if touched, it will cause burning pain.
